Dear Nanna,

I’m getting married in Iceland next June and my fiancé and I are really stoked. The wedding pictures alone will be epic.

But last week a really close friend of mine announced she’s getting married the same month as me. Not in Iceland mind you, but in June next year I mean. I get that June is a really popular month for weddings, but she’s known I wanted to get married in June next year (06. 06. 2016) forever and it just seems a little inconsiderate. Should I confront her with how I feel?

Best

Bride-to-Be

Dear Bride-to-be,

The nerve! To plan a wedding in the same month that you and millions of other couples the world over are planning their weddings? I think you should punish that presumptuous bitch with your absence and not go to her wedding. That way you can passive-aggressively remind her that not everything is about her and what she wants.

Congratulations on your engagement by the way, I have a good feeling about you guys!

Nanna
